From The Indianapolis Star, Tuesday, June 7, 1921: A system of “personal ratings” has been introduced at Arsenal Technical High School for all graduating seniors. The comprehensive report will not only include scholastic attainments, but also general ability and personal characteristics so parents and businesses seeking information of Tech graduates may know their qualifications. The personal ratings of more than 3,000 Tech students are made up of from reports of the faculty who have been in contact with the student during the school year. The “personal rating” includes physique, cleanliness, neatness, public speaking, written composition, honesty, reliability, thrift, courtesy, judgment, perseverance, open mindedness, cooperation with others, self-control, courage, and self-respect. It gives credit for student activities in athletics, school organizations, and service to the school community. It also embraces “extra school” activities such as Scouting and other social service organizations.
